8 // Query canonicalization in IE
9 // ----------------------------
10 // IE is very permissive for query parameters specified in links on the page
11 // (in contrast to links that it constructs itself based on form data). It does
12 // not unescape any character. It does not reject any escape sequence (be they
13 // invalid like "%2y" or freaky like %00).
15 // IE only escapes spaces and nothing else. Embedded NULLs, tabs (0x09),
16 // LF (0x0a), and CR (0x0d) are removed (this probably happens at an earlier
17 // layer since they are removed from all portions of the URL). All other
18 // characters are passed unmodified. Invalid UTF-16 sequences are preserved as
19 // well, with each character in the input being converted to UTF-8. It is the
20 // server's job to make sense of this invalid query.
22 // Invalid multibyte sequences (for example, invalid UTF-8 on a UTF-8 page)
23 // are converted to the invalid character and sent as unescaped UTF-8 (0xef,
24 // 0xbf, 0xbd). This may not be canonicalization, the parser may generate these
25 // strings before the URL handler ever sees them.
27 // Our query canonicalization
28 // --------------------------
29 // We escape all non-ASCII characters and control characters, like Firefox.
30 // This is more conformant to the URL spec, and there do not seem to be many
31 // problems relating to Firefox's behavior.
33 // Like IE, we will never unescape (although the application may want to try
34 // unescaping to present the user with a more understandable URL). We will
35 // replace all invalid sequences (including invalid UTF-16 sequences, which IE
36 // doesn't) with the "invalid character," and we will escape it.
